How much do associate network eng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for associate network engineer in Geneva, IL is $80,651.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$63,900.00 and $92,700.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an associate network engineer?

An Associate Network Engineer is an entry-level IT professional responsible for assisting in the design, implementation, and maintenance of network systems. They help troubleshoot connectivity issues, configure hardware such as routers and switches, and support network security measures. Their role often involves collaborating with senior engineers to optimize performance and ensure reliable communication across an organization's infrastructure. This position serves as a foundation for advancing into higher-level network engineering roles.

What are some common challenges faced by associate network engineers and how can I overcome them?

Associate Network Engineers often encounter challenges such as troubleshooting complex connectivity issues, adapting to rapidly changing network technologies, and balancing multiple support requests at once. To navigate these hurdles, it's important to build a strong foundation in network theory, regularly update your knowledge through certification studies or training, and leverage available documentation and team support. As you gain experience, you'll develop strategies for prioritizing issues, automating routine tasks, and communicating effectively with both technical and non-technical colleagues. Embracing ongoing learning and seeking mentorship can help you grow your expertise and confidence in the role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an associate network engineer?

To thrive as an Associate Network Engineer, you need a solid understanding of networking fundamentals, troubleshooting skills, and a relevant degree or equivalent experience. Familiarity with network hardware, protocols, operating systems, and certifications such as CompTIA Network+ or Cisco CCNA is highly valued. Strong analytical thinking, effective communication, and the ability to work collaboratively on a team are important soft skills for this position. These abilities ensure reliable network performance, smooth issue resolution, and productive collaboration in dynamic IT environments.

Position Overview
Our client is seeking a motivated and customer-focused Associate Network Engineer to join a growing engineering team. This role is ideal for an early-career networking professional who enjoys a blend of technical problem-solving, client interaction, and hands-on infrastructure support.
The Associate Network Engineer will provide Tier 1-3 technical support across client environments and internal systems, assisting with network administration, implementation projects, troubleshooting, escalations, and ongoing client engagement. This position offers the opportunity to work alongside experienced engineers while developing expertise across multiple technologies, including networking, cloud, and security platforms.
Key Responsibilities
  • Provide Tier 1-3 technical support for client and internal infrastructure environments.
  • Troubleshoot network, connectivity, systems, and security-related issues.
  • Manage and resolve support escalations in a timely and professional manner.
  • Participate in client implementation and deployment projects.
  • Collaborate with clients to understand technical requirements and deliver effective solutions.
  • Coordinate with vendors, OEMs, and third-party providers to resolve technical issues.
  • Perform root cause analysis (RCA) and document findings and resolutions.
  • Assist with network monitoring, maintenance, upgrades, and performance optimization.
  • Maintain accurate documentation of network configurations, procedures, and support activities.
  • Participate in an on-call rotation to support business and client needs.
  • Work closely with engineering team members to share knowledge and support successful project delivery.

Required Qualifications
  • Current Cisco Certified Network Associate (CCNA) certification.
  • 1-3 years of professional IT, networking, infrastructure, or technical support experience.
  • Experience supporting two or more technology domains, including networking, cloud, cybersecurity, systems administration, or related technologies.
  • Strong troubleshooting and analytical skills.
  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ills.
  • Demonstrated ability to interact professionally with clients and business stakeholders.
  • Ability to manage multiple priorities in a fast-paced environment.

Preferred Qualifications
  • Experience within a Managed Service Provider (MSP), consulting, or client-facing environment.
  • Exposure to cloud platforms such as Microsoft Azure or AWS.
  • Familiarity with firewalls, VPNs, wireless technologies, and network security concepts.
  • Additional technical certifications are a plus.
